The Ship Inspection Report Programme (SIRE) has long served as a cornerstone in the maritime sector for assessing vessel conditions and operational excellence. However, the industry is now witnessing a paradigm shift with the introduction of SIRE 2.0, a state-of-the-art digitalized tanker inspection program.

Spearheaded by the Oil Companies International Marine Forum (OCIMF), this innovative initiative marks a significant step forward in modernizing vessel evaluation methodologies and ensuring enhanced safety standards across the maritime domain.

Navigating the Implementation of SIRE 2.0: A Closer Look at Phase 1

The rollout of SIRE 2.0 unfolds across four meticulously planned stages, each designed to ensure a seamless transition and optimal performance. Currently in Phase 1, which encompasses rigorous internal testing, a collaborative effort involving OCIMF’s secretariat, appointed inspectors, submitting firms, and vessel operators is underway.

This comprehensive evaluation process scrutinizes every aspect of the system, paving the way for subsequent phases and reinforcing the program’s commitment to excellence.

Commencing Phase 1 of the groundbreaking SIRE 2.0 tanker inspection initiative marks a pivotal moment in enhancing vessel vetting procedures.

The meticulous phased rollout, tailored to address stakeholder feedback, ensures both the program and its users are thoroughly prepared to embrace this innovative approach to tanker assessment.

Optimizing Tanker Evaluation: Leveraging the Advantages of Pre-Vetting Inspections

Owners stand to gain significant advantages through Pre-Vetting inspections, aligning their vessels with the latest mandates of OCIMF SIRE 2.0. The integration of tablet-based inspections, dynamic question sets, heightened focus on human factors, and a comprehensive overhaul of inspection protocols underscore the transformative impact of SIRE 2.0.

These enhancements not only streamline the inspection process but also revolutionize the approach to evaluating tankers across various sizes.
